Achieving Efficiency Through Continuous Improvement
Continuous improvement is a vital strategy for any company that seeks to enhance its efficiency. By implementing a culture of ongoing assessment, businesses can pinpoint areas where output can be improved. Continuously reviewing operations allows for the execution of tactics that streamline workflows, lower waste, and ultimately result in a more productive atmosphere.

Developing a Culture of Continuous Improvement
Building a culture of continuous improvement demands a change in mindset. It's about encouraging a regular desire to discover areas for development and implementing solutions to achieve ongoing improvement. This necessitates a dedication from the entire organization to contribute in the process, sharing feedback and collaborating to achieve common objectives.
